Title: Vince Traynelis: Innovator in Vertebral Plate Technology
Introduction
Vince Traynelis is a notable inventor based in Iowa City, IA (US). He has made significant contributions to the field of medical technology, particularly in the area of spinal surgery. His innovative approach has led to the development of a unique retention system for screws used in vertebral plates.
Latest Patents
Vince Traynelis holds a patent for a "Method and apparatus for retaining screws in a plate." This invention addresses the challenge of maintaining screws in a vertebral plate. The system includes one or more screws that extend through apertures within the vertebral plate. A cavity is positioned adjacent to and overlaps into the aperture. A ring is positioned within the cavity and held in place by a cap. The cap attaches to the plate to prevent the removal of the ring. The ring is designed to be deflectable between two shapes: one that allows for the insertion and removal of the screw, and another that prevents the screw from backing out.
